The Choirboys (1977)
The Choirboys offers a raw and unfiltered glimpse into the lives of police officers, blending humor with poignant moments that reveal the emotional struggles beneath their tough exteriors. With a unique premise that juxtaposes wild nightlife against the backdrop of law enforcement, this film explores the complexity of brotherhood and the high stakes of their nighttime escapades. Viewers who appreciate character-driven narratives will find themselves drawn into the chaotic yet heartfelt journey of these men, as they navigate the fine line between duty and personal freedom. It's a compelling watch for anyone seeking a mix of laughter, heart, and a deeper understanding of the human experience behind the badge.
